The dealer is trying to blow you off until the warranty is done.
NO CEL should come on under normal operation - if one does, it means there is something wrong and it needs to be fixed.
Make sure you save your receipt from when the dealer scanned the code. Even if you go past 36k miles, as long as you had the first problem before the warranty expired, you will still be covered. Go back and tell them to fix it. Every single CEL has a diagnostic subroutine in the service manual, and NONE of them say "Send the customer home and tell them it is normal."
